Package: xulrunner
Version: 1.8.0.1-10
Severity: serious
From my pbuilder build log:
...
# Add here commands to configure the package.
JAVA_HOME=/usr/lib/jvm/java-gcj \
MOZCONFIG=debian/mozconfig \
CFLAGS="-Wall -pipe" \
LDFLAGS="-Wl,--as-needed" \
./configure --host=i486-linux-gnu --build=i486-linux-gnu \
--enable-optimize="-O2 -g" \
--with-java-include-path=`if readlink -f
/usr/lib/jvm/java-gcj/include/jni.h; then echo /usr/lib/jvm/java-gcj/include;
else mkdir /tmp/buildd/xulrunner-1.8.0.1/debian/include; ln -s
/usr/lib/gcc/*/*/include/jni.h /tmp/buildd/xulrunner-1.8.0.1/debian/include/;
echo /tmp/buildd/xulrunner-1.8.0.1/debian/include; fi` \
Adding configure options from debian/mozconfig:
--enable-application=xulrunner
--prefix=/usr
--enable-default-toolkit=gtk2
--enable-pango
--enable-xft
--disable-freetype2
--enable-system-cairo
--with-system-png
--with-system-jpeg
--with-system-zlib
--with-system-bz2
--with-gssapi=/usr
--without-system-nspr
--enable-xinerama
--enable-single-profile
--disable-profilesharing
--enable-svg
--enable-svg-renderer=cairo
--enable-mathml
--disable-pedantic
--disable-long-long-warning
--enable-gnomevfs
--enable-gnomeui
--disable-tests
--disable-debug
--enable-canvas
--disable-xpcom-obsolete
--enable-js-binary
--with-readline
--enable-extensions=default cookie permissions
--disable-installer
--enable-javaxpcom
--enable-chrome-format=flat
--enable-native-uconv
--disable-elf-dynstr-gc
configure: warning: /usr/lib/jvm/java-gcj/include: invalid host type
creating cache ./config.cache
checking host system type... i486-pc-linux-gnu
checking target system type... Invalid configuration
`/usr/lib/jvm/java-gcj/include': machine `/usr/lib/jvm/java' not recognized
checking build system type... i486-pc-linux-gnu
...
checking MOZ_GNOMEUI_LIBS... -lgnomeui-2 -lSM -lICE -lbonoboui-2
-lgnome-keyring -lxml2 -lz -lgnomecanvas-2 -lgnome-2 -lpopt -lart_lgpl_2
-lpangoft2-1.0 -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lgdk_pixbuf-2.0
-lpangocairo-1.0 -lfontconfig -lXext -lXrender -lXinerama -lXi -lXrandr
-lXcursor -lXfixes -lpango-1.0 -lcairo -lX11 -lgnomevfs-2 -lbonobo-2 -lgconf-2
-lgobject-2.0 -lbonobo-activation -lORBit-2 -lm -lgmodule-2.0 -ldl
-lgthread-2.0 -lglib-2.0
configure: error: jni.h was not found in given include path
/usr/lib/gcc/i486-linux-gnu/4.1.1/include/jni.h.
make: *** [config.status] Error 1
(Those messages about it trying to interpret /usr/lib/jvm/java-gcj/include
as a host type look strange.)
--
Daniel Schepler